Ray J's Thanksgiving Turmoil: Alleged Gun Incident Rocks Livestream!

William Ray Norwood Jr., widely known as Ray J, was reportedly arrested on Thursday, November 27, after an alleged incident involving his ex-wife, Princess Love. The 44-year-old singer was taken into custody by Los Angeles police and subsequently charged with making a criminal threat. The arrest followed reports of assault with a deadly weapon and domestic violence. Officers responded to the scene, and Ray J, the younger brother of renowned singer Brandy, was booked at the LAPD’s Van Nuys Station. He was later released on a $50,000 bond, according to jail records.
The alleged confrontation, which reportedly occurred on Thanksgiving, was livestreamed and captured on video footage published by TMZ. The clip appears to show Ray J engaged in a heated argument with Princess Love, 41, primarily concerning the custody of their two children, daughter Melody Love, 7, and son Epik Ray, 5. During the edited footage, Ray J allegedly brandishes a gun, prompting Love, who was holding one of their children at the time, to state, “You just pointed a gun at me.” Ray J, however, denies the accusation of pointing a firearm. The livestream reportedly began with Ray J expressing his distress, claiming it was “the worst Thanksgiving in the f—king world.” Furthermore, the video is said to show him holding a gun and uttering a threat, stating, “If these n—s step foot close to this door I’m going to blow this f—king s—t away, bro.”
Ray J and Princess Love share a history that includes starring together on the popular VH1 reality series, Love & Hip Hop: Hollywood, which aired from 2014 to 2019. The couple married in 2016, but their relationship has been tumultuous, with Princess Love filing for divorce for the fourth time in 2024, as reported by People magazine. Their custody dispute appears to be an ongoing point of contention.
Beyond this recent domestic incident, Ray J has also been in the news for other legal matters. He recently filed a countersuit against Kim Kardashian and Kris Jenner. In this countersuit, he alleges that they intentionally released the sex tape featuring him and Kim Kardashian, which played a significant role in launching Kim’s career. He further claims that they then “peddled the false story” that the tape was leaked, implying a calculated effort to control the narrative surrounding its release.
